Spectroscopic characterization and laser performance of resonantly diode-pumped Er 3+ -doped disordered NaY(WO 4 ) 2
2011
We report what is believed to be the first resonantly pumped laser operation based on Er3+-doped disordered double tungstate single crystal. Efficient laser operation of an Er3+:NaY(WO4)2 laser at ∼1609.6 nm was demonstrated with the naturally wideband, ∼20 nm, InGaAsP/InP laser diode pumping at ∼1501 nm. Laser wavelength tunability of ∼34 nm was also demonstrated based on disorder-broadened emission features of Er3+:NaY(WO4)2 single crystal.
